The attunement ICD is not 1 second, but there is a global CD of 4 seconds.

Also, One With Air doesn’t stack in intensity. Yes you can get 3 seconds of superspeed each time you attune to air, but even with instantly double attuning to air you’ll never reach above the 3 seconds.
Twist of Fate is a 1.5s on demand super speed but in terms of maintaining the buff it can only do 3.75% by itself. We can reuse the skill every 5 seconds if we have a charge like you said, but a charge takes 40 seconds to recharge. The strength of it is stunbreak, removal of 3 conditions with Unravel Hexes and on demand escapes – not as a maintained source of superspeed.
Same goes with Unravel Hexes. Incredibly interesting trait for condition removal, but as a super speed source it’ll be unreliable (triggers when you get cripple/chill/immobilise) with a cooldown of 15s.

In short, you can’t maintain super speed unless you; always crit, can hit things consistently, have alacrity/weave self to lower attunement recharge and fresh air. Any other scenario than that we won’t have permanent super speed – albeit still a pretty high one (attuning air – X element back and forth would give ~50% upkeep)

This seems to be a worry for many people I’ve talked to so far, but remember we’re all judging the Weaver mechanics from the limited picture of what we’ve seen so far. We don’t know exactly how it’ll turn out, or even if it will be a problem.

To leave a suggested solution to your problem though, there seems to be at least two ways to circumvent the mentioned problem and access offhand skills of any attunement reactively:

1, Use fresh air and go into target attunement —> crit --> go into air
2, Use the utility “Unravel” (max 2 charges, one charge takes 25s to recharge) to forego the weaver attunement mechanic for 5 seconds and fully attune to the elements.

So with the Weaver we can now have two attunements at once, one for skills 1-2 and one for 4-5, #3 being mixed.

What happens with the glyphs that are affected by attunement, and the traits that give bonuses or condition applications based on your current attunement? The way I see it there’s two possibilities: both, or just the 1-2 “main” attunement.

If it is both, we could do some interesting tricks with fresh air to gain water-dps-traits for “free”. Say we start in fire-air —> (swap to water) --> water-fire —> crit to recharge the 3s cd on air --> (swap to air) —> air-water. One hit we’d be in fire-air, the next air-water.

This means fresh air offers a way to instantaneously access offhand skills of any attunement assuming crits are attainable, which could resolve some worries I’ve read about Water attunement and healing.

This is something I’ve spent some time looking at and it’s pretty important if you want to squeeze the maximum amount of DPS out of a D/ build (condi or power).
I’ve explained it to some extent on reddit before and I made a short video showcasing it on a medium hitbox.

Basically ever since the FGS “Fiery Rush” nerf a few years ago, fire trails cannot stack closely together. This fixed the admittedly broken fiery rush skill, but also affected burning speed as well as burning retreat (Flame axe version as well but w/e). The fix was that multiple trails that spawn too close to each other will be voided, making it impossible to stack a large number of them on the same spot.

This means that we want to stack the Burning speed trails as closely as possible under the hitbox without putting the trails all on each other. There’s a sweet spot dependant on the travel distance and the size of the hitbox, but I’ve had more success getting a feeling for how to do it right rather than giving it exact numbers I can’t relate to in a real fight.
From what I’ve tested a medium hitbox can only get 2 trails under, and a large hitbox can get all 4 if used correctly. This is pretty difficult on the large golem, but much easier on a stationary Slothasor/Samarog (in which case you pretty much want to travel as far as possible, starting outside the hitbox circle).

I’ve been doing lots of DPS tests on the ele lately.. What I’ve gotten are no ‘one time wonders’ but averaged results over consecutive runs:

  • All buffs medium golem D/W: 37.7k
  • All buffs large golem D/W: 42.2k
  • All buffs medium golem staff: 36.5k
  • All buffs large golem staff: 46.8k

Is staff or D/W best? Tested with qTs ‘realistic buffs’ setting:

  • Medium: D/W: 28.2k – Staff: 26.5k
  • Large: D/W: 33.1k – Staff: 33.6k

Now, staff scales better with alacrity and in these settings I have 0. D/W scales better with targets movement, which is also impossible to test well in the training arena.
I know, you can use the moving golem. However, that will just show D/W as superior, raid bosses don’t move quite that much.

I’d say D/W is always better damage.
Only in a setting with zero movement, permanent alacrity and a Slothasor’s sized hitbox staff pulls ahead slightly. Slightly as in ~3%, in a scenario that will never be reality.

Go staff if you need the utility of ranged dps or if you’re figthing the Ice Elemental in the Snowblind Fractal. Otherwise always D/W.
That means even for Bloomhunger or Molten Duo or similar. All of those bosses have a much smaller hitbox than Sloth’s making D/W roughly 8% better than staff.

In a group setting, where multiple people are acquiring the Static Charge buff, I would probably buy it’s higher DPS, just because of how fast you can reapply it.

Static Charge has the same coefficient of Sigil of Air which has an estimated DPS of 709 (taken average of ~50 strikes). The Static Charge is applied to 5 players and with a decent fresh air rotation the overload air, and hence Static Charge, will happen every 10-12 seconds.

Assuming the optimal scenario of 10 seconds, 709*3*5/10 = 1063 groupwide bonus DPS or 212 as personal bonus DPS. Safe to say it’s not much but it’s something

Okay, so I went in to compare sigil of accuracy over sigil of air for staff ele in the most optimal set ups for both with and without Spotter.

In terms of EP, I got following (I disregarded damage multipliers as they will work as linear coefficients which won’t change the comparison):

Without Spotter:

  • Accuracy: 13994
  • Air: 13460

With Spotter:

  • Accuracy: 14163
  • Air: 13988

So going accuracy over air we get an increase of 3.97% EP without spotter or 1.25% with. Air sigil seem to have an annoyingly large variance of hitting 1.5-3k. After taking the average of ~50 strikes I got 2126, making it a 709 single target DPS increase. I’d love to take a bigger sample to make this estimation more accurate.

Assuming the damage on a single target is all that matters, then we can calculate the required DPS we need in order for accuracy > air.

  • X > 709/0.0397
  • X > 709/0.0125

where X is the required DPS and the two cases for spotter and without spotter.
Now the result, remember that the estimation here is with a final DPS number after an entire fight and not a number gotten after dummy practice.

  • Without spotter: 17859
  • With spotter: 56720

Now make your conclusion! I don’t think there’s a clear winner in the case of no-spotter but Air clearly wins in cases with.

You’re definitely right that 100% burn duration is required, however when comparing the two different build you can’t just look at the condition damage.

Your build gain 329 extra condition damage cause of suboptimal traits when looking at highest achievable DPS (arcane is better than earth, pyromancer’s training better than power overwhelming).

With the correct viper build the comparison then turns into:

Viper with Berserker runes:

  • 2264 power
  • 1597 condition power
  • 80.19% condi duration (100% burn)
  • 5% direct damage multiplier

Sinister with Balth runes:

  • 2055 power
  • 1856 condition power
  • 34.76% condition duration (100% burn)

End result with Viper on LHS and Sinister on RHS:

209 power + 5% direct damage + 5 bleeds from sigil of earth vs. 259 condition power.

Have a look at this for power/precision/ferocity breakpoints. Simply find the cell that corresponds with your crit damage and power in a chosen scenario to find the optimal crit chance.
With revenants, ferocious winds and LH we are able to go beyond 244% but since no meta build uses LH it shouldn’t be an issue.

Assassin staff or assassin earrings have the exact same stat (1 power vs 1 precision on dual wields), so if only berserker earrings are available to you you can choose assassin’s weapon.

Note though that the precision balance will vary a bit depending on what build you go. Fresh air builds will have an additional 190 precision from Aeromancer’s Training, take spotter into the consideration and it’s very easy to overcap. In simple terms, this is what I usually go for. For infusions I have power.

Staff:

  • Berserker with assassin earrings, maintenance oil and truffle steak = 98.4% crit chance
  • With spotter: Berserker with assassin earrings, maintenance oil and Bowl of Curry Butternut Squash Soup= 99.8% crit chance

Fresh Air:

  • Berserker with assassin earrings, Sharpening stones and seaweed sallad = 99.37% crit chance
  • With Spotter: Berserker with berserk earrings, Sharpening stones and seaweed sallad = 100.7% crit chance

And yes, the difference you’d see from those few assassin pieces are in the 0.1% margin.

On most skills there is an ‘aftercast’, a delay before you can do another action. If you cast a skill and directly jump off the edge, you won’t be able to deploy your glider until the aftercast time has passed.
